Position Summary:

  • The Central Processing Technician plays a critical role in ensuring the cleanliness, functionality, and readiness of equipment used in patient care, such as IV Pumps, Suction Equipment, Orthopedic Equipment, and Defibrillators. This position is responsible for cleaning and assembling respiratory boxes, processing soiled equipment returned to Central Processing, and staging all cleaned items according to established guidelines. The Central Processing Technician also inspects rechargeable equipment for compliance and functionality, documents production activities, and communicates any issues to management. This role supports clinical operations by maintaining high standards of safety, accuracy, and accountability in a fast-paced healthcare environment.

Responsibilities:

  • Responds to requests, for cleaning equipment in a timely manner.
  • Notify appropriate management with explanation if unable to process all of the soiled equipment within Central Processing by the end of the shift.
  • Notifies supervisor when it is necessary to reorder supplies.
  • Restocks assigned area with supplies needed to clean and check equipment.
  • Must wear designated gloves, face shield, gown, head and foot coverings before entering and during any time spent in the decontamination area.
  • Follows established guidelines as appropriate for cleaning all soiled equipment returned to Central Processing.
  • Assembles and stages as designated all respiratory boxes.
  • When exiting the decontamination area all protective covering must be removed immediately to prevent spread of possible contact infectious contaminations.
  • Use established recording methods for accountability of all production.
  • Report to supervisor or Retail Storeroom phone person when work is completed and be available for reassignment.
  • Participate in department meetings/action planning and physical inventories with Materials Management.
